Implement hybrid coordinate cache warming strategy: piggyback coords via CP flag when they fit within transport MTU, send standalone CoordsWarmup (0x14) message when they don't. On CoordsRequired or PathBroken receipt, send CoordsWarmup immediately with source-side rate limiting (default 2s per destination, configurable). - Add CoordsWarmup = 0x14 session message type (empty body, CP flag) - Add send_coords_warmup() following send_session_msg() pattern - Restructure send_session_data() to send standalone warmup before data packet when piggybacked coords exceed MTU - Add immediate CoordsWarmup response in handle_coords_required() and handle_path_broken() with per-destination rate limiting - Add coords_response_interval_ms config (node.session) - Add RoutingErrorRateLimiter::with_interval() constructor - Zero transit-path changes: existing try_warm_coord_cache() handles CoordsWarmup identically to CP-flagged data packets - Update design docs (session layer, wire formats, mesh operation, configuration)
FIPS Design Documents
Protocol design specifications for the Federated Interoperable Peering System — a self-organizing encrypted mesh network built on Nostr identities.
Reading Order
Start with the introduction, then follow the protocol stack from bottom to top. After the stack, the mesh operation document explains how all the pieces work together. Supporting references provide deeper dives into specific topics.
